The photo that reflects the drama of immigration from Africa to Europe – Univision

The border agents could not believe when the control screen luggage appeared the figure of a child in a suitcase.

The incident occurred on Thursday at the land border between Ceuta and Morocco, passing by dozens of people daily. The authorities found that a woman was nervous as he waited in line.

When his turn came the officers required to pass the suitcase the scanner, where they observed a human figure of a child. The agents opened the suitcase immediately and provided health care to children.

An hour after the incident a person of Ivory Coast with a residence permit in Spain approached the crossing, which aroused police suspicions. After several questions admitted he was the child’s father who was in the suitcase and was immediately arrested, the Civil Guard said in a statement.

Agents, after detecting the child, opened the suitcase and found the youngest of eight years.

The father, who had recently denied family reunification, said in court that no he knew his son was going to cross the border in this way.

The Spanish court ordered Friday the imprisonment of a man who hid to her eight years in a suitcase to go to Spain in the enclave of Ceuta in North Africa.

father, a native of Ivory Coast, Morocco and the woman carrying the suitcase with the child inside are accused of “a crime against the rights of foreign citizens.” Ceuta’s government took over custody of the child.

The Strong economic differences between Europe and Africa as well as the instability that many countries live in the region, pushing each year, thousands of people try to make the jump to Europe seeking various ways. In recent weeks, several thousand immigrants have died when the boat they were traveling in were sunk in the Mediterranean.
